You can jump on top of waves to reach new shortcuts, for instance. Your vehicles are also amphibian now, becoming proto jet-skis whenever you touch water. There’s also the inclusion of motorbikes as optional vehicles. However, a few new elements were brought over from Mario Kart Wii and Mario Kart 8 in particular, namely some antigrav-esque sections where you venture through high-speed canals full of trademarked Nickelodeon slime. Its predecessor was a blatant Mario Kart clone with a unique power-up/crew system, which is retained in this version, and it’s still its main gameplay-related highlight.
